Understanding the Registration Process

Registering a car in California involves several key steps that are designed to ensure vehicle safety and compliance with state regulations. The process begins with gathering essential documents, including proof of ownership, insurance, and identification. Once you have these ready, it’s time to visit or contact the Department of Motor Vehicles (DMV). There, you’ll need to pass a vehicle inspection, which often includes a check using a DMV vin verifier to confirm the car’s identity and history. This step is crucial as it ensures that your vehicle meets safety standards and has not been reported stolen.

After passing the inspection, you can proceed with filling out the necessary forms and paying the registration fees. The DMV will issue a registration certificate, which you’ll need to keep in your vehicle at all times. Gathering Necessary Documents

cars

Before you begin the registration process, ensure you have all the essential documents ready. The California Department of Motor Vehicles (DMV) requires a range of information to verify your vehicle’s ownership and history. One crucial step is to obtain a Vehicle Identification Number (VIN) verification from a reliable source. You can use a DMV-approved VIN verifier, such as a mobile vin verifier or conduct a mobile vin inspection to retrieve this unique code. This process is essential to ensure the vehicle’s authenticity and avoid any legal complications.

Gathering these documents, including the title, registration papers, proof of insurance, and identification, will streamline the registration at your local DMV office. Steps to Register Your Vehicle in California

cars

Registering a car in California involves several straightforward steps. First, ensure your vehicle meets all safety and emissions standards by visiting a certified smog test center. Obtain a clear title from the seller if purchasing from a private party. Next, visit a California Department of Motor Vehicles (DMV) office or use their online services to apply for registration. You’ll need key documents like proof of identity, residency, and insurance.
